Our verdict is Likely benign. Variant got -4 ACMG points: 0P and 4B. BP4_Strong
The NM_174981.6(POTED):c.173G>A(p.Arg58Lys) variant causes a missense change involving the alteration of a non-conserved nucleotide. In-silico tool predicts a benign outcome for this variant. 12/19 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★).

Uncertain significance, criteria provided, single submitter | clinical testing | Ambry Genetics | Jul 06, 2021 | The c.173G>A (p.R58K) alteration is located in exon 1 (coding exon 1) of the POTED gene. This alteration results from a G to A substitution at nucleotide position 173, causing the arginine (R) at amino acid position 58 to be replaced by a lysine (K). Based on insufficient or conflicting evidence, the clinical significance of this alteration remains unclear. - |
